About
As the golden hues of fall embrace the Montana landscape, prepare for an unforgettable RV camping adventure that lives in harmony with nature's rhythm. Just a stone's throw away from bustling Missoula, our pastoral retreat offers 26 sprawling acres of rural tranquility, where your mornings are greeted with dew-kissed foliage, and your evenings are serenaded by awe-inspiring sunsets at our renowned "Sunset Point." Indulge in the rustic charm of our vibrant chicken community at the Wicked Hens Club and Mother Cluckers Saloon, where 61 free-range hens lay a spectrum of colorful eggs, ready for you to purchase and enjoy. Admire the craftsmanship of repurposed materials that make up their unique haven, and listen for the sounds of our musically named farm residents, from Ike Turner the rooster to Silkie chickens like Billy Idol in the misfits' paddock. Our farm is a symphony of bucolic bliss, with bees diligently crafting exquisite honey, available for you to savor. Revel in the playful antics of our fainting goats, Freddy, Shaggy, and Scooby, against a backdrop of pastoral fields dotted with our friendly Hereford steers and the charming Black Baldy, LaFonda. Explore our sustainable practices with grass-fed and grass-finished beef, a testament to our farm's commitment to quality and environmental consciousness. Take a leisurely stroll down a country road to the nearby Kelly Island Fishing Access for a serene day by the Clark Fork River. And when the day wanes, gather around our fire pit for epic bonfires under the starlit Montana sky. As a family-friendly oasis, our land brims with joy, from wagging tails of adorable Labrador puppies to the curious gaze of our Maine Coon cat, Luci. However, please be mindful of our amicable but protective yellow labs when bringing along your smaller furry companions. For RV campers with a flair for culinary experiences, we welcome the use of bar-b-ques and grills to craft your delicious meals. If your travels require propane, take advantage of exclusive savings available through local connections. Please contact us ahead of your arrival to ensure smooth navigation to our property, steering clear of GPS misdirections and catering to larger rigs. House Rules
Please don't let children enter areas where our chickens or goats are without an adult present. Please make sure to close any gate that you have opened.
Items to Purchase
Free-range, farm fresh eggs for sale from our beautiful 132 hens. Fresh honey from our happy hives. Seasonal fruits and vegetables from our garden. Bagged ice. Lots of canned goods from our garden. Fresh bread if available.
